基于SpringBoot的旅游网站的设计与实现开题报告

 2023-08-05 06:08

1. 研究目的与意义

随着人们生活水平提高,旅游出行需求日益增长,出现了很多的旅游资源整合商和旅游服务提供商,他们在旅游领域深耕,推出了很多定制化个性化的旅游产品,这些产品不但性价比较高,而且包含机票、酒店、旅游目的地等,方便了消费者,深受消费者的喜爱,逐渐出现了很多OTA,如同程、携程等。

传统的旅行社也意识到了在线旅游平台的重要性,纷纷建立自己的旅游网站,旅游网站不但适合小型旅行社,对于大中型旅行社一样适宜。

OTA的出现将原来传统旅行社销售模式放到网络平台上,更加广泛的传播了线路信息,也更加方便了客人的咨询和订购,可以有效的促进旅游资源的利用,为传统旅行社提供有力的竞争力。

剩余内容已隐藏,您需要先支付后才能查看该篇文章全部内容!

2. 课题关键问题和重难点

1、本文的关键问题(1)SpringBoot框架设计SpringBoot 是由Pivotal 团队提供的全新的Java 框架,该框架的提出是为了简化Spring 应用的开发及搭建过程。

该框架实现了自动配置免去了原本Spring 的种种繁琐的配置文件,使SpringBoot 可以快速简便的开发一个应用,同时SpringBoot 内嵌了Tomcat 服务器让部署更加简单。

(2)mybaits框架技术MyBatis是一个持久层框架,它可以简单的对数据库进行映射,简化了Java 对数据库的操作。

剩余内容已隐藏,您需要先支付后才能查看该篇文章全部内容!

3. 国内外研究现状(文献综述)

孙岩(2021)研究了基于SpringBoot的旅游资源管理网站的设计与实现。

文中提出使用SpringBoot MyBatis作为后端框架完成网站的逻辑判断和处理,使用模板引擎Thymeleaf当作前端页面,设计并实现了一个内容充实,简单易用的特色旅游资源管理网站。

系统测试表明,该网站可以正确的实现访问、注册、登录、攻略发布等功能[1]。

剩余内容已隐藏,您需要先支付后才能查看该篇文章全部内容!

4. 研究方案

1、系统设计方案本网站主要采用MVC设计模式。

模型层使用MyBatis 来负责对实现业务的实体类进行操作以访问数据库,控制层使用SpringBoot 框架,主要负责业务中的流程管理、实现业务逻辑。

视图层使用query框架实现与用户的交互。

剩余内容已隐藏,您需要先支付后才能查看该篇文章全部内容!

5. 工作计划

2022-2022-1学期:第15-16周:完成选题,查阅相关中英文资料。

第17周:与导师沟通进行课题总体规划。

第18-19周:导师下发毕业设计(论文)任务书,学生根据导师的要求进行外文翻译,列出开题报告大纲,进行开题报告的撰写。

剩余内容已隐藏,您需要先支付 10元 才能查看该篇文章全部内容!立即支付

发小红书推广免费获取该资料资格。点击链接进入获取推广文案即可: Ai一键组稿 | 降AI率 | 降重复率 | 论文一键排版